Barry-Wehmiller Future Leaders Program – MBA Internship

The Barry-Wehmiller Future Leaders Program places interns in high-visibility roles, reporting directly to a business unit’s executive team, with responsibility for leading strategic initiatives that help determine the future of Barry-Wehmiller. This will include owning end-to-end deliverables that are critical to the company’s success and prepare you to be a Barry-Wehmiller leader.

Our successful candidates have been top talents with a track record of high-performance and driving impact. Capabilities include strong communication skills, advanced analytical and problem-solving capabilities, and a bias towards joining a purpose-driven culture where Everybody Matters – note that the culture is so deeply embedded in our purpose that our CEO wrote a book about it! As part of the program, each intern will be placed in a Future Leaders Program track (listed below) that aligns with their passions and capabilities. In your cover letter, please list your top two tracks, any additional information about your interest in that track, and any long-term locational preferences. The internship will be in St. Louis, MO, with full-time opportunities dependent on role (please note that Barry-Wehmiller has hundreds of locations across the world) to be discussed during the interview process.

  • Corporate Strategy: Lead initiatives focused on the growth of a business by assessing capabilities, growth drivers, and other strategic levers. Perform analysis to enable key factors of strategic plan (e.g., creating new pricing methodologies developed through data analysis and customer insights)
  • Product Management: Develop deep understanding of a product and its drivers of market success, resulting in faster and more sustainable growth (e.g., defining an integrated product launch strategy; developing an innovation roadmap)
  • Marketing: Drive key business go-to-market strategies by leveraging customer insights, search engine optimization (SEO), AI, and more (e.g., performing market studies to define market size, potential, and entry strategy – e.g. build vs. buy; developing a proactive marketing campaign)
  • Financial Planning & Analysis: Lead financial analyses for driving better business decisions (e.g., performing an assessment of opportunities based on a machine’s footprint and the positioning of our products in the market; developing a strategy for improving working capital levels)
  • Operational Excellence & Supply Chain: Lead operational improvement and supply chain projects (e.g., designing an updated manufacturing process to enable higher throughput; performing supply chain assessments that uncover savings opportunities)
  • People Strategy: Lead people analytics, compensation and incentives, strategic workforce planning, and cultural programming (e.g. develop talent matrices, market talent analysis, and technology trends: ready BW for the future of work, develop international pay structures and incentive plans, and measure ROI on L&D programs)

About Barry-Wehmiller

Barry-Wehmiller is a privately held, global company with 12,000 team members. BW is composed of 5 business units that span Industrial & Packaging Automation, Professional Services, and Life Sciences Technology. Our companies create machines that make things you touch every day, such as the soda cans you buy at the grocery store, the boxes you receive at your doorstep, and the medical technology behind life-saving medical devices and therapies.
